Magnuson Hotels Sets up For UK Launch

A well known independent hotel group in the United States, Magnuson Hotels, is now gearing up for a UK launch come April 5th. The company, which was founded by Tom and Melissa Magnuson in 2003, now represents some 1100 properties in the United States. The company is able to open up about 50 new hotels every month.

This company will soon be offering independent British hotels. They hope to increase their online presence on more than 2,000 internet booking channels. This includes such sites like Expedia and Travelocity.

Tom Magnuson said that the Magnuson Hotels will fill a gap in the UK market. He went on to say that they see a need in the UK market, and they plan to fill it. Some 63 percent of hotels outside London are not represented on the GDS. Their goal is to help represent the unrepresented.

Mr Manguson went on to say that the hotels that they represent can maintain their own independence; however, they will have the online presence of belonging to a chain. Magnuson Hotels offers a lower cost alternative to the traditional franchise models that are currently out there.

Magnuson Hotels will be offering preferential rates for travel agents booking directly with them. They also plan to work closely with travel management companies. Also, according to Magnuson, the hotel group’s technology and its strength of online presence will allow TMC’s to quickly find a member property to suit their clients’ needs and budgets.

Mr Magnuson finished up by saying that hotel brands are becoming less and less important to consumers. It is now estimated that less than 25 percent of consumers have any brand loyalty in their choice of travel companies.
